Ticket: Config drift in Ledgerwing admin table after bulk edits

For the weekly eng sync: we confirmed that the bulk-edit tool in the Ledgerwing admin table writes directly to the live config store but skips the audit hook, so staging and production have quietly diverged over the past three sprints. Marisol traced eleven rows where retry limits and timeout fields no longer match the declared baseline. We propose freezing bulk edits until the hook is fixed. For reference, the current production values are as follows.

service settings:
PRAIX_LOG_LEVEL=error
PRAIX_METRICS_HOST=metrics.praix.qorvelcorp.corp
PRAIX_POOL_SIZE=16

**Ticket: Transcode farm creds expired**

For the weekly sync: the Quillcast transcoding farm stopped pulling jobs Tuesday because the worker fleet's credential lapsed. Backlog hit ~4k videos before anyone noticed — we need alerting on auth failures, not just queue depth. I minted a replacement credential with a 90-day expiry and a calendar reminder this time. New key below.

API key for yahig-tadup: kto7_ubizbYm

## Environments — Furrowlink Telemetry Gateway

The Furrowlink gateway ingests telemetry from tractors and harvesters across three environments: dev, staging, and production. Support should note that device heartbeats in staging use a shortened interval, so timeout alerts there are expected and safe to ignore. Production is the only environment paged on. The production gateway runs with the following configuration values.

settings of fawip-yadug:
[druath]
port = 3000
region = north-4
host = druath.qirvanworks.corp
timeout_ms = 1500
retries = 1

## Step 2: Port your relevance overrides

Querystone 4 drops the legacy boost syntax. Plugin authors must re-register scorers through the new tuning interface before upgrading. Field weights, decay curves, and synonym penalties all move into the central relevance profile; per-plugin overrides are ignored otherwise. Test against the staging index at Harbrook first. The relevance engine reads these configuration values at profile load time.

service settings:
[ulair]
team = praath
access_code = ac_06d704
owner = wenix.ulair
host = ulair.qirvancorp.corp
port = 9200
peer = sorys.nelvronet.internal
salt = 2668132c
pin = 9140